Sorry, no one that is really consistent. I know it's in BC but I would recommend Victoria Plating. Every person I've sent there has been extremely happy with the results.
One customer had a dash piece for a 50's Cadillac done 3 times at a shop in the interior of BC. The first 2 times, pitting was still visible ... the third time, it had so much plating on it, it wouldn't fit in the opening anymore. He was frustrated and looking for another one to get chromed when I suggested Steve's shop. He talked to him that day, sent off the replated,replated, replated piece and just over a week later (for less than the cost at the first shop) he got the piece back in perfect condition and it fit as it was supposed to.
That's a typical Victoria Plating story!
The finish on pedlondarite's spoke covers is another example of the quality of their work. It's been how many years since they did your spokes? I know it will likely outlast the original finish from the factory.
